Binance is good for buy/withdraw?
« on: March 25, 2021, 10:58:41 AM »
Their withdrawal fee is steep but other than that they're fine

Use Coin base Pro if you don't want to pay high fees.



They charge you 0.0005 Btc for a withdraw
